Skip to main content

Simplify and automate Odoo.sh deployment using GitLab and GitHub.

Project description

odoo-sh-gitlab-ci

This package simplifies and automates the process of updating Odoo.sh branches by interacting with a GitLab repository while using a GitHub repository as a container for multiple repositories. It ensures seamless management of submodules and branch synchronization, making the deployment process more efficient and maintainable.

Installation

Install the package using pip:

pip install odoo-sh-gitlab-ci

Usage

To deploy, simply execute the following command:

odoo-sh-deploy

Ensure the required environment variables are defined before running the command.

License

This project is licensed under the AGPL-3.0 License.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

odoo_sh_gitlab_ci-1.0.0.tar.gz (2.6 kB view details)

Uploaded Source

File details

Details for the file odoo_sh_gitlab_ci-1.0.0.tar.gz.

File metadata

  • Download URL: odoo_sh_gitlab_ci-1.0.0.tar.gz
  • Upload date:
  • Size: 2.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.14

File hashes

Hashes for odoo_sh_gitlab_ci-1.0.0.tar.gz
Algorithm Hash digest
SHA256 cfed0f81e3d0073c3495916dfa7e81c3dca293940aa96b049a8707f1fcd92a0d
MD5 590f4a6d92422ef54a478b892d9204ab
BLAKE2b-256 b465d3ecc716c342c6c00132ae80f3efad3bdbe82879a0a1b698d3d5260cdebc

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page